The three new Xbox Series X|S consoles that were announced in June have landed in Australian stores today.
The three consoles are:
The new Limited Edition Galaxy Black Xbox Series X which includes at 2TB SSD and a custom console and controller design. It will cost $999 AUD and it’s available HERE.
There’s also the first all-digital Xbox Series X and that comes in White with a 1TB SSD and will cost $699 AUD and that can be purchased HERE.
Lastly, the Xbox Series S now comes in a 1TB white model to join the previously released black model. This costs $549 AUD and it’s available HERE.
